OLYMPIA, Wash. – With just six players dressed and ready for action, the Evergreen Geoducks put up a strong effort but couldn’t hold off the deeper Northwest Christian Beacons, falling 86-70 in a Cascade Conference men’s basketball game on Sunday night at CRC Gymnasium in Olympia, Wash.

After a lay-up by Patrick Lewis (Bremerton, Wash./Olympic College) gave the Geoducks (1-18, 0-10 CCC) the initial lead, the Beacons (10-12, 3-7 CCC) took it back on a three-ball by Trevor Parker and never looked back.  NCU pushed the lead to 11 with 14:25 to go in the opening period but the Geoducks buckled down and battled back into single digits.  A jumper by Travis Pacos with 39 second left gave Northwest Christian the 43-32 halftime lead.

In the second half, Evergreen continued to battle as the differential hovered around 10 for most of the period.  The Beacons finally wore down the short-handed Geoducks towards the end as NCU earned the 86-70 win.

Evergreen was led by 18 points off the bench from Elzie Dickens (Seattle, Wash./Highline CC).  Lewis finished with 16 points and 18 rebounds for the double-double while Larry Green (Seattle, Wash./Grays Harbor CC) added 13 points.  Sophomore Mike DeRosier (Puyallup, Wash./South Puget Sound CC) added 11 as four of the six Evergreen players finished in double-digit scoring.

Northwest Christian was led by 22 points from Brian Hampton.  Mitchell Wilson, Pacos and Tyler Fox all added 11 while Brody McGowan and Jordan Buhler each chalked up 10.  14 of 15 Beacons listed on the roster played at least a minute in the game.
